Bridging the gap between international law and foreign policymaking.
|
"Lawyer and diplomat ... are not even attempting to talk to each
other, turning away in silent disregard. Yet both purport to be
looking at the same world from the vantage point of important
disciplines. It seems unfortunate, indeed destructive, that they
should not, at the least, hear each other."
The above statement was made by renowned international lawyer and former state department official Louis Henkin in 1979. (1) Professor Henkin was bemoaning what he saw as a significant and disturbing gap in communication between the international legal community and the ...
